| Its common for the bottom to be tempered but not the sides.If the sticker was on the bottom I would think the bottom is tempered but not the sides.I've never personally seen or heard of a 55 having tempered sides.

| Be careful! I was doing a similar search for information on drilling aquariums. Marineland (Perfecto) has a document on their website that specifies which panels (if any) of their aquariums are tempered. Their 55G has all panels tempered! I am not sure what brand you have. I looked on Aqueon's website (All Glass Aquariums) and couldn't find a similar document.
